如何开发王者荣耀 开发王者荣耀需要具备哪些技术
王者荣耀作为一款现象级的MOBA手游,拥有庞大的玩家群体。那么如何开发出像王者荣耀这样成功的游戏呢?这需要从多个方面进行考量和精心策划。
**一、明确游戏定位与目标受众**
首先要精准定位游戏类型。王者荣耀定位为MOBA手游,这种类型融合了策略竞技与团队协作,深受广大玩家喜爱。在确定类型后,需明确目标受众。它涵盖了各个年龄段和不同性别,但核心玩家群体以年轻人为主,他们热衷于竞技对抗,追求游戏中的成就感。针对这一受众,游戏在操作难度、画面风格、角色设定等方面都进行了优化,以吸引并留住玩家。比如简单易上手的操作,精美的动漫风格画面,丰富多样且个性鲜明的英雄角色,满足了不同玩家的喜好。
**二、打造优质游戏内容**
英雄设计至关重要。每个英雄都要有独特的技能机制、背景故事和美术风格。像李白,其技能华丽且富有诗意,背景故事充满传奇色彩,深受玩家追捧。 游戏的地图布局要合理,野怪分布、防御塔位置等都经过精心设计,以保证游戏的公平性和策略性。还要不断更新游戏内容,如推出新英雄、新皮肤、新玩法模式等,保持游戏的新鲜感和吸引力。例如每隔一段时间就会上线新英雄,让玩家有新的角色可以尝试和研究战术。
**三、注重游戏平衡性**
这是MOBA游戏的核心要点。要确保每个英雄在不同的游戏阶段都有合理的强度,避免出现过于强势或弱势的英雄。通过对英雄数据的不断调整和优化,让游戏中的对战更加公平。比如在游戏更新中,会根据英雄的出场率、胜率等数据,对其技能伤害、冷却时间等进行微调,以维持游戏的平衡生态。
**四、优化游戏性能**
流畅的游戏体验是吸引玩家的关键。从游戏的加载速度、画面帧率到网络稳定性,都需要进行极致优化。减少游戏卡顿、掉帧等问题,让玩家能够尽情享受游戏过程。开发团队会不断进行技术研发,采用先进的图形处理技术和网络优化算法,提升游戏性能,确保在各种移动设备上都能有出色的表现。
**五、构建社交互动系统**
王者荣耀强大的社交功能也是其成功的因素之一。玩家可以组队开黑、添加好友、加入战队等。通过社交互动,增加了游戏的粘性和趣味性。比如战队系统,玩家可以与队友一起参与战队赛,为战队荣誉而战,还能在战队中交流游戏心得,增进团队凝聚力。
**FAQ问答**
1. 开发王者荣耀需要具备哪些技术能力?
需要掌握游戏开发相关的编程语言,如C++、Java等,还要熟悉图形处理技术、网络编程技术等多方面的能力。
2. 开发过程中如何保证游戏的创新性?
不断进行市场调研,关注行业动态,从其他优秀游戏或文化作品中汲取灵感,鼓励团队成员提出新的创意和想法,并进行可行性验证。
3. 如何确保游戏的更新内容能得到玩家认可?
提前收集玩家的反馈和建议,在更新前进行小规模测试,根据测试结果对更新内容进行调整和优化,确保新内容符合玩家的期待。
4. 开发游戏时如何控制成本?
合理规划开发流程,优化资源利用,采用成熟的技术框架,避免不必要的功能开发,与供应商协商争取更有利的合作条件等。
5. 对于新开发的类似MOBA游戏,有哪些经验可以借鉴王者荣耀?
注重游戏平衡、打造优质内容、优化性能、构建良好社交系统,同时要不断创新玩法,满足玩家日益多样化的需求。